Output 1ec25362ef9aadbbcea2a28a6d57d85a27a8756ad108d297303cbaabcdd8df29:2

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2140c96668acaa9af408df5f60c0e3634baaa946 OP_EQUALVERIFY OP_CHECKSIG
address
142punrQPKH7aZQqrtaN24ycw8PFvBL6W2
transaction
1ec25362ef9aadbbcea2a28a6d57d85a27a8756ad108d297303cbaabcdd8df29
confirmations
492384
spent
true